What you’ll do Responsibilities Design, build, productionize, and maintain APls, services, and systems across Stripe's engineering teams using Ruby, React, Typescript, and other programming languages. Predict and measure the performance and outcomes of designed systems. Collaborate with engineers and other cross-functional roles across the company to build new billing features at large-scale to make it easier to businesses for collect and manage their payments. Analyze user needs, feedback, and product requirements to determine technical specifications and the feasibility of design and implementation, taking cost and time constraints into account. Implement technical designs through a series of programming tasks while upholding high engineering standards. Implement unit, functional, and integration tests to prevent bugs and regressions. Improve engineering standards, tooling, and processes ensuring operational excellence and contribute to team's on-call rotation. Debug and identify the root cause of errors in a complex system across multiple service components. Provide mentorship and help onboard and spin up new hires for the team. Who you are Minimum requirements Bachelor’s degree or foreign equivalent in Computer science, Human-Computer Interaction or related fields, plus 18 months of software engineering experience. This position requires following: 1.5 years of experience working with Ruby, React, Typescript, and other relevant programming languages and frameworks; 1.5 years of experience translating business needs into software requirements and designs and implementing industry standard design patterns; 1.5 years of experience with using SQL or related query languages to perform data analysis; 1.5 years of experience working with API development, participating in team's oncall to provide emergency response, and debugging production issues across services; 1.5 years of experience leading cross team projects, scoping implementation plans, and managing cross team dependencies; and 1.5 years of experience participating in team's on-call rotation, providing emergency responses, debugging and mitigating production issues. Additional benefits for this role may include: equity, company bonus or sales commissions/bonuses; 401(k) plan; medical, dental, and vision benefits; and wellness stipends. - WA11 #LI-DNI In-office expectations Office-assigned Stripes in most of our locations are currently expected to spend at least 50% of the time in a given month in their local office or with users. This expectation may vary depending on role, team and location. For example, Stripes in Stripe Delivery Center roles in Mexico City, Mexico, Bengaluru, India, and Dublin, Ireland work 100% from the office. Also, some teams have greater in-office attendance requirements, to appropriately support our users and workflows, which the hiring manager will discuss. This approach helps strike a balance between bringing people together for in-person collaboration and learning from each other, while supporting flexibility when possible.
